AHIMA Community
Outreach Triumph Award
Recipient
Christine Staropoli, MS,
RHIA, CCS
Congratulations to
LVHIMA member
Christine Staropoli,
MS, RHIA, CCS,
recipient of the
AHIMA Community
Outreach Triumph
Award. The Community
Outreach Award
honors those HIM
professionals or
groups who have
embraced the need
for public outreach
and encouraged the
overall management
of health
information. The
nominee should have
provided information
on HIM topics to the
public (e.g.,
medical identity
theft, HIPAA, and
privacy/confidentiality.
Activities should
include
presentations,
development of
toolkits, innovative
programs, and other
forms of outreach
focused on
empowering consumers
to be proactive
participants in
their healthcare
using health
information.
